Transaction 23d750617a0290685cb895badc666d7c4f5c117503bc8732e061f7aa7a75910f
2 Input
2 Outputs
- 23d750617a0290685cb895badc666d7c4f5c117503bc8732e061f7aa7a75910f:0
- 23d750617a0290685cb895badc666d7c4f5c117503bc8732e061f7aa7a75910f:1
value 753112
address 112iDUijKo2XN3x9ftD1zzF7NuMdgMmUE5
value 1440000
address 38bRc56Eiq4iH7eNU58w5DdtFwQBo1oYVp